The principals of the Red Hill Stud are very excited about promoting the Australian White Sheep Breed. At last we are seeing a unique breed of sheep that meets the Australian market requirements and is suited for varying Australian conditions.
In 2011 Robert and Leanne Endacott purchased embryos from Tattykeel, Oberon and joined Australian White rams to their large self-replacing commercial flock of White Dorper ewes. The difference in the lambs was immediate, producing progeny with increased size and strong growth rates.
At Red Hill, Robert and Leanne are committed to breeding a sheep that produces a marketable lamb with excellent growth rates, stud ewes and rams with good shedding ability and hair pattern and a good temperament.
